收藏
回答

AggregateCommand 无法比较时间 ?

有没有人遇到相同的问题?

如果可以请回复下。

谢谢

最后一次编辑于  2020-06-22
回答关注问题邀请回答
收藏

1 个回答

  • Mr.Zhao
    Mr.Zhao
    2020-06-22

    也不亮代码,什么样的时间格式?猜猜猜呢

    2020-06-22
    有用
    回复 4
    • 李明
      李明
      2020-06-22
      数据库存储的 date 与 date 对象进行比较 
      用了两个函数均无效

      方法一:canPay:$.cmp([‘$time’, tTDate ])




      函数二:
      $.cond({
                 if: $.lt([‘$time’, tTDate]),
                          then: 1,
                          else: 0
                        })


      用库里的时间字段 time 与  tDDate 对象进行比较
      2020-06-22
      回复
    • Mr.Zhao
      Mr.Zhao
      2020-06-22回复李明
      到底存的啥,是new Date()吗
      2020-06-22
      回复
    • 李明
      李明
      2020-06-22
      是啊。两边 都是 new Date() 的对象
      2020-06-22
      回复
    • Mr.Zhao
      Mr.Zhao
      2020-06-22回复李明
      dateFromString 转成字符串再比较,最好还是存时间戳
      2020-06-22
      回复
登录 后发表内容
问题标签